Пошаговая инструкция — как удалить CUDA Toolkit на Ubuntu

CUDA Toolkit — это набор инструментов и библиотек, разработанных компанией Nvidia, которые позволяют разработчикам использовать GPU для ускорения вычислений. Однако, возникают ситуации, когда необходимо удалить CUDA Toolkit с системы Ubuntu. Будь то из-за возникших проблем или необходимости обновления версии, удаление CUDA Toolkit требует определенных действий.

В этой статье мы расскажем о пошаговой инструкции, как удалить CUDA Toolkit на Ubuntu.

Шаг 1: Проверьте установленные пакеты CUDA

Перед удалением нам необходимо убедиться, что CUDA Toolkit установлен на вашей системе. Откройте терминал и выполните следующую команду:

nvidia-smi

Эта команда отобразит информацию о вашем GPU и установленной версии CUDA Toolkit. Если вы видите эту информацию, значит CUDA Toolkit установлен на вашей системе.

Шаг 2: Удалите CUDA Toolkit

Для удаления CUDA Toolkit нам необходимо выполнить несколько команд в терминале. Откройте терминал и выполните следующую последовательность команд:

  1. Удалите CUDA Toolkit:
    sudo apt-get remove --autoremove cuda
    
  2. Удалите пакеты, связанные с CUDA:
    sudo apt-get remove --autoremove nvidia-cuda-toolkit
    
  3. Удалите загрузчик CUDA:
    sudo apt-get remove --autoremove nvidia-*
    
  4. Обновите список пакетов:
    sudo apt-get update
    

После выполнения этих команд CUDA Toolkit должен быть полностью удален с вашей системы Ubuntu.

Шаг 3: Проверьте удаление CUDA Toolkit

Для проверки того, что CUDA Toolkit успешно удален, откройте терминал и выполните команду:

nvidia-smi

Теперь вы знаете, как удалить CUDA Toolkit с системы Ubuntu. Удаление CUDA Toolkit может быть полезным в случае проблем или необходимости обновления версии. Следуйте нашей пошаговой инструкции и вы сможете успешно удалить CUDA Toolkit.

Шаг 1: Остановка сервисов CUDA Toolkit

Перед удалением CUDA Toolkit необходимо остановить все связанные с ним сервисы. Выполните следующие действия:

  1. Откройте терминал.

    Для этого нажмите клавиши Ctrl+Alt+T.

  2. Остановите службу NVIDIA Persistence Daemon.

    Введите следующую команду и нажмите клавишу Enter:

    sudo systemctl stop nvidia-persistenced

    Вам может потребоваться ввести пароль администратора.

  3. Остановите службу NVIDIA Cuda Compiler.

    Введите следующую команду и нажмите клавишу Enter:

    sudo systemctl stop nvcc

    Вам может потребоваться ввести пароль администратора.

  4. Проверьте, что службы успешно остановлены.

    Введите следующую команду и нажмите клавишу Enter:

    sudo systemctl status nvidia-persistenced nvcc

Шаг 2: Удаление пакетов CUDA Toolkit

После того как удалены все зависимости, можно приступить к удалению пакетов CUDA Toolkit.

1. Откройте терминал и выполните следующую команду:

sudo apt-get purge cuda*

2. Введите ваш пароль, если потребуется.

3. Подтвердите удаление пакетов, нажав «y» и нажмите Enter.

4. Дождитесь окончания процесса удаления. Это может занять некоторое время.

Теперь пакеты CUDA Toolkit будут удалены с вашей системы Ubuntu.

Шаг 3: Удаление CUDA Toolkit из переменных среды

После того как вы удалили пакеты CUDA Toolkit с вашей системы, следует также очистить соответствующие переменные среды. Вот как это сделать:

  1. Откройте терминал.
  2. Введите команду sudo nano /etc/environment, чтобы открыть файл переменных среды в текстовом редакторе nano.
  3. Найдите строку, содержащую путь к CUDA Toolkit, и удалите ее. Обычно эта строка выглядит следующим образом: PATH="/usr/local/cuda-/bin:$PATH".
  4. Нажмите Ctrl+O, затем Enter, чтобы сохранить изменения в файле.
  5. Нажмите Ctrl+X, чтобы закрыть текстовый редактор.

Теперь переменные среды не содержат ссылок на удаленный CUDA Toolkit, и вы успешно завершили процесс удаления CUDA Toolkit с вашей системы Ubuntu.

Шаг 4: Удаление CUDA Toolkit драйверов

1. Откройте терминал и выполните следующую команду:

sudo apt-get purge nvidia-cuda*

2. Введите пароль администратора и нажмите Enter.

3. Подтвердите удаление, нажав «Y» и Enter.

4. Дождитесь завершения процесса удаления.

5. Перезагрузите компьютер, чтобы изменения вступили в силу:

sudo reboot

Теперь все драйверы CUDA Toolkit будут удалены с вашей системы.

Шаг 5: Удаление CUDA Toolkit из загрузочных настроек

  1. Откройте терминал.
  2. Введите команду sudo update-alternatives --remove-all cuda и нажмите Enter.
  3. Выполните команду sudo update-initramfs -u для обновления загрузочных настроек.
  4. Перезагрузите систему, введя команду sudo reboot в терминале.

После перезагрузки системы CUDA Toolkit и связанные с ним настройки загрузки будут полностью удалены. Вы можете проверить успешное удаление CUDA Toolkit, выполнив команду nvcc --version в терминале. Если CUDA Toolkit был удален корректно, вы увидите сообщение о том, что команда nvcc не найдена.

Шаг 6: Удаление CUDA Toolkit директорий

Чтобы полностью удалить CUDA Toolkit с вашего Ubuntu, вам также необходимо удалить его директории в системе. Вот как это сделать:

  1. Откройте терминал.
  2. Введите следующую команду, чтобы удалить директорию с CUDA Toolkit:
  3. sudo rm -rf /usr/local/cuda-X.X

    Где X.X — версия CUDA Toolkit, которую вы хотите удалить.

  4. Введите следующую команду, чтобы удалить директорию с NVIDIA GPU Computing SDK:
  5. sudo rm -rf ~/NVIDIA_GPU_Computing_SDK

  6. Введите следующую команду, чтобы удалить директорию с NVIDIA CUDA Samples:
  7. sudo rm -rf ~/NVIDIA_CUDA_Samples

После выполнения всех этих шагов вы успешно удалите CUDA Toolkit с вашего Ubuntu.

Шаг 7: Проверка наличия остатков CUDA Toolkit

После удаления CUDA Toolkit необходимо проверить, остались ли еще какие-либо остатки на вашей системе. Чтобы это сделать, выполните следующие действия:

  1. Откройте терминал и введите команду:

    ldconfig -p | grep cuda
  2. Если в результате выполнения команды будет найдено какое-либо упоминание о CUDA Toolkit, это означает, что на вашей системе остались остатки. В этом случае, удалите остатки вручную, следуя инструкциям по поиску и удалению файлов или используя специальные утилиты для поиска и удаления фрагментов программ.

  3. Если в результате выполнения команды не будет найдено никаких упоминаний о CUDA Toolkit, это означает, что удаление прошло успешно и все остатки были удалены. Вы можете считать процесс удаления CUDA Toolkit завершенным.

После проверки наличия остатков CUDA Toolkit, вы можете быть уверены в полной его удалении. Теперь вы можете продолжить работу с вашей системой Ubuntu без установленного CUDA Toolkit.

Оцените статью